National Taco Day Will Now Be On A Tuesday Thanks To Taco Bell

Taco lovers wide and far are familiar with Taco Tuesday, a day that not only celebrates one of the most delicious handheld classics, but also offers the best deals. Taco Tuesday, however, has never been an official day of celebration. 

National Day Calendar, the original and authoritative source for fun, unusual, and unique National Days, created National Taco Day to remedy that. Unfortunately, that day only lands on Tuesday roughly once every five to six years. Well, thanks to Taco Bell, that changes today.

Taco Bell has convinced National Day Calendar to move National Taco Day to Tuesdays starting this year. Taco lovers can now officially celebrate this iconic food on the first Tuesday of October, forever. It’s safe to assume that Taco Bell has some amazing deals up its sleeve come October 1st.
